Czech Republic expects resumption of oil supplies via Druzhba on August 12-13


The operator of the Czech section of the Druzhba oil pipeline, which passes through the territory of Ukraine, Mero expects the resumption of Russian oil supplies within two days, August 12-13, since problems with transit payments will be resolved, about this informs Reuters, citing company representative Yaroslav Pantuchek.

According to him, “the customer MOL has taken appropriate steps to ensure the operation of the southern part of the pipeline for Slovaks and Hungarians. Our customer told me that he is taking identical steps, so I expect that very soon - either tomorrow or the day after tomorrow - oil will also flow to us, ”he said.

By “appropriate steps,” Pantuchek meant paying a transit fee, due to problems with which, on August 4, Ukrtransnafta suspended the transit of Russian oil through Ukrainian territory to Hungary, Slovakia and the Czech Republic. The reason was the inability to pay for services after the introduction of the seventh package of European sanctions. sent through Gazprombank the payment was returned to the account of Transneft, the adviser to the president of the company saidTransneft”, the Russian operator of Druzhba, Igor Demin. He clarified that the Ukrainian company provides oil transportation services on a 100% prepayment basis.

Now the transit of Russian oil has been resumed to Hungary and Slovakia, after the day before, on August 10, local operators, the Hungarian oil and gas company MOL and the Slovak plant Slovnaft, agreed with the Ukrainian side and independently paid for the transit of oil. Oil began to flow on the same day at 16:00 Moscow time.

The Druzhba pipeline starts in the Samara region, passes through Bryansk, and then splits into two branches: northern and southern. The northern oil flows through Belarus in the direction of Poland, Germany and the Baltic States, the southern - to the Czech Republic, Hungary and Slovakia.
